Water Pollution (Fees) (Amendment) Regulations, 2006 (L.N. No. 330 of 2006).

Abstract
These Regulations repeal and replace the Schedule to the Water Pollution (Fees) Regulations, 2001. The Schedule specifies various fees relating to water pollution and related authorizations. Services for which charges are payable under rule 17(4) include consideration of applications and the use of specialized expertise external to the Authority. Charges paid to the Authority pursuant to rule 17(4) which exceeds $10,000.00 shall require a statement of expenses from the Authority identifying the cost items that resulted in the charges exceeding $10,000.00.”
